For more than a century, Westcott House has served the Church and society by training priests for ministry in Anglican churches around the world. Our objective is to equip the Church's ministers with a robust faith, a deep-rooted spirituality and the intellectual rigour to relate the Christian gospel to a world of continuing change.

For Anglican ordinands, Westcott offers all the benefits of residential theological education:

  • Full-time preparation for ministry with a wide range of academic courses and a strong emphasis on contextual learning through an extensive range of placements
  • Deep immersion in the rhythms of daily prayer
  • The joy and challenge of living and working together

Westcott Ordinands

If you are a Church of England ordinand, you may wish to seek the advice of your Diocesan Director of Ordinands about the best time to apply. We normally see people shortly after or shortly before their Bishops’ Advisory Panel. Further information about ministry in the Church of England is available at http://www.cofe-ministry.org.uk/ (new window).

If you are an ordinand from elsewhere in the Anglican Communion, we will normally need to know that you have been approved to begin training by whatever procedures are normal for your Province and/or Diocese.

We are able to provide training for ordinands from other denominations (especially from the Lutheran churches which are part of the Porvoo or Meissen agreements). If you are interested, please get in touch and we will discover what is possible.
